HTML validation fixes for iPhone meeting agenda

- Legacy-Id: 2191
This commit is contained in:
Pasi Eronen 2010-03-22 15:12:12 +00:00
parent 180ebe42b4
commit 808cd3e47f

View file

@ -6,10 +6,11 @@
{% block head %}
<link href="http://tools.ietf.org/css/palette.css" rel="stylesheet" type="text/css" />
<link rel="apple-touch-icon" href="/images/agenda-touch-icon.png" />
<script language='javascript' src='http://tools.ietf.org/js/prototype-1.6.0.2.js'></script>
<script language='javascript' src='/js/agenda.js'></script>
<script src="/js/dateformat.js" language="javascript" ></script>
<script type="text/javascript" src='http://tools.ietf.org/js/prototype-1.6.0.2.js'></script>
<script type="text/javascript" src='/js/agenda.js'></script>
<script type="text/javascript" src="/js/dateformat.js"></script>
<script type="text/javascript">
//<![CDATA[
function on_load_actions() {
set_cookie_colors();
set_location();
@ -20,7 +21,7 @@
utc.setMinutes(now.getMinutes() + now.getTimezoneOffset());
var loc = utc;
// Switch page location 1 hour after local time, to give stragglers some leeway.
loc.setHours(utc.getHours() + {{meeting.time_zone}} - 1);
loc.setHours(utc.getHours() + {{meeting.time_zone|default_if_none:"0"}} - 1);
localtime = loc.format("%Y-%m-%d_%H%M");
var anchors = document.getElementsByTagName("a");
for (var i = 0; i<anchors.length;i++){
@ -34,6 +35,7 @@
}
}
//]]>
</script>
{% endblock %}
{% block body_attributes %}onload="on_load_actions()"{% endblock %}
@ -51,7 +53,7 @@
{% ifchanged %}
<tr>
<td colspan="4">
<a name="{{slot.meeting_date|date:"Y-m-d"}}_0000" /a>
<a name="{{slot.meeting_date|date:"Y-m-d"}}_0000" />
<h4>{{ slot.meeting_date|date:"l"|upper }}, {{ slot.meeting_date|date:"F j, Y" }}</h4>
</td>
</tr>
@ -76,16 +78,19 @@
{% endif %}
<tr>
<td colspan="4">
<a name="{{slot.meeting_date|date:"Y-m-d"}}_{{slot.time_desc|slice:":4"}}" /a>
<a name="{{slot.meeting_date|date:"Y-m-d"}}_{{slot.time_desc|slice:":4"}}" />
<h5>{{slot.meeting_date|date:"D"}} {{ slot.time_desc }} {{ slot.session_name }}
{% ifequal slot.sessions.0.acronym "plenaryw" %}
- {{ slot.sessions.0.room_id.room_name }}</h5>
<pre>{{ plenaryw_agenda|escape }}</pre>
{% endifequal %}
{% else %}
{% ifequal slot.sessions.0.acronym "plenaryt" %}
- {{ slot.sessions.0.room_id.room_name }}</h5>
<pre>{{ prenaryt_agenda|escape }}</pre>
{% else %}
</h5>
{% endifequal %}
{% endifequal %}
</td>
</tr>
@ -113,7 +118,7 @@
{% for session in slot.sessions %}
<tr>
<td colspan="4">
<a name="{{slot.meeting_date|date:"Y-m-d"}}_{{slot.time_desc|slice:":4"}}" /a>
<a name="{{slot.meeting_date|date:"Y-m-d"}}_{{slot.time_desc|slice:":4"}}" />
{{ slot.time_desc }} {{ session.acronym_name|escape }} - <a href="http://tools.ietf.org/agenda/{{meeting.num}}/venue/?room={{session.room_id.room_name|slugify}}">{{ session.room_id.room_name}}</a>
</td>
</tr>